Mariapoala McGurk, or MP as she is known, is the Public Programmes Coordinator at Constitutional Hill andis currently working on developing the Creative Uprising Hub. MP started the Coloured Cube in 2014 in a warehouse in Benrose as a space for creatives to meet and connect. This grew into the Co-Lab, a communal space where creatives could have access to shared tools and equipment as well as peer support and training. Constitution Hill has held many cultural festivals and creative programmes so an institutional framework for cultural networking is already in place.  Enter the third player in this creative hub: Robbie Brozin of Nando’s fame (and flame) who has always been a visionary, lobbied for local, backed the creative industry and been a supporter of entrepreneurship and change makers.  With so many creatives having to abandon their careers after the devastating effects of Covid Lockdown as well as the shocking mismanagement of the sector’s funding from the Presidential Employment Stimulus Programme, one only hopes that this initiative is not too late for a decimated industry.  Renos Nicos Spanoudes chats to Mariapoala during Saturday’s Role on Hellenic Radio.
